FPGApuolella is a concept or term that appears to originate from Finnish, translating to "on the FPGA side" or "FPGA-side." It generally refers to computations or processing that are implemented directly on a Field-Programmable Gate Array (FPGA). FPGAs are integrated circuits that can be programmed to perform a wide variety of digital logic functions. This contrasts with processing performed on traditional CPUs or GPUs.
